- 1). Decide where in the front of your house you want to have the porch. Many times a front porch is an extension of the front entry way.
- 2). Measure the area where you want the porch.
- 3). Measure the outside of your house.
- 4). Draw the outside perimeter of your house on paper using the architectural scale and triangles. A typical house floor plan is drawn at a 1/4- or 1/8-inch scale.
- 1). Decide on the design of your front porch.
- 2). Look at different magazines, books, and what is around your existing neighborhood to find out what options you have and what goes best with your style and the house.
- 3). Decide if you want an open porch design or an enclosed porch.
- 4). Draw the layout of the front porch on your floor plan using the same architectural scale as the floor plan.
- 5). Draw an elevation of the front porch so that you can show what it looks like from all sides.
